I have a probate that has not yet been opened due to complications but has been filed. 
 
A creditor has already filed a claim for less than $1000.00. Does the person petitioning for PR even have authority to allow or reject the claim? I know if no rejection is given for two months it is deemed accepted. Does this apply even if probate is not opened?
